Produktbeschreibung
ECG: ESSENTIALS OF ELECTROCARDIOGRAPHY is designed to help you understand the fundamental knowledge and skills necessary to successfully perform an ECG. Its concise yet comprehensive coverage includes instruction on the anatomy of the heart, electrophysiology of the heart, and ECG basics. To prepare you for completing ECGs in the field, this student-friendly text presents a combination of introductory cardiovascular anatomy, relationships of other body systems to heart health, need-to-know legal and ethical considerations, patient assessment techniques, instructions on how to complete and document ECGs, and basic interpretation of the ECG tracing. "Call-outs" point out material you should memorize, while "Quick Checks" help you test your comprehension as your progress through the text. In addition, thorough coverage of objectives you must master to qualify to sit for the National Healthcareer Association's (NHA) EKG Technician Certification exam are included throughout.
Autorenporträt
Cathy D. Soto, Ph.D., is a lifelong educator who retired from El Paso Community College after serving for 14 years as program coordinator of the Medical Assisting Program, where she taught all 12 courses including the ECG course. Prior to that, she taught part time for eight years in EPCC's Computer Information Systems Department while also teaching computer programming and medical administrative classes full time as a secondary educator. Dr. Soto taught full time as a secondary educator for a total of 17 years. In addition, she has owned and operated her own business -- Global Education Company -- since 1985. A successful grant writer, Dr. Soto wrote and administered a state grant under the "self-sufficiency welfare to work" program and was funded for $64,500 for the EPCC MA program. A proud veteran, she was honorably discharged from the U.S. Navy after serving four years as a medical assistant during the Vietnam era. Additionally, Dr. Soto has an extensive volunteer and community service background, most notably serving on the Regional Girl Scout Board of Directors for three terms (12 years) and one term on her church finance council (three years).
